Transform Your Home with Upcycled Decor Items
Are you looking to add a touch of creativity and sustainability to your home decor? Consider incorporating upcycled decor items into your living space. Upcycling is the process of transforming old or discarded materials into something new and beautiful. Not only does upcycling help reduce waste, but it also adds a unique charm to your home. In this article, we will explore some creative decor items made from upcycled materials that you can easily incorporate into your home.
1. Reclaimed Wood Wall Art

Old wooden pallets or barn wood can be repurposed into stunning wall art pieces. Whether you paint a scenic landscape, create a geometric design, or simply arrange the wood in an abstract pattern, reclaimed wood wall art adds warmth and character to any room.
2. Vintage Suitcase Shelves

Give old suitcases a new lease on life by turning them into unique shelves. Stack suitcases of varying sizes and colors to create a visually appealing storage solution. These vintage suitcase shelves are not only functional but also serve as a conversation piece in your home.
3. Mason Jar Chandeliers

Upcycle glass mason jars into a charming chandelier for your dining room or kitchen. Simply affix the jars to a wooden or metal base, add fairy lights or candles inside, and hang the chandelier from the ceiling. The soft glow emitted by the mason jar chandelier adds a cozy ambiance to your space.
4. Tire Ottoman

Turn an old tire into a stylish ottoman by wrapping it with rope or fabric and adding a cushioned top. This upcycled tire ottoman not only serves as a seating option but also brings an industrial chic vibe to your decor.
